About the role

Software Project Manager - Braking & Vehicle Motion Software

Join us to shape the software behind advanced braking, ESP, and vehicle motion control systems for next-generation vehicles in the fast-growing Chinese automotive market. Our team aims to become a leading software engineering partner by delivering complete software projects end-to-end, from requirement analysis and development to integration, testing, release, functional safety, and cybersecurity compliance.

Why this role is exciting

• Work on safety-critical automotive software that directly contributes to vehicle stability, braking performance, and driving safety.

• Gain hands-on exposure to braking systems, in-vehicle communication, functional safety, cybersecurity, and next-generation E/E architectures.

Collaborate with automotive experts from Bosch Germany, China, India, and Vietnam on real vehicle platform projects.

Apply AI, automation, dashboards, and data-driven methods to improve project planning, risk tracking, requirement analysis, and delivery efficiency.

• Grow from project execution into technical leadership in one of the most important domains of modern mobility.

What you will do

Own software project delivery from acquisition phase to final release, ensuring quality, cost, and delivery targets are met.

• Act as the key interface between Technical Project Manager and the software development team, bridging customer needs with technical execution.

• Translate customer needs into clear software requirements, delivery plans, and development priorities together with technical experts.

Drive project execution using structured planning, risk management, milestone tracking, and AI-supported productivity tools to enhance efficiency.

Lead cross-functional problem solving for braking software topics, including requirement changes, integration issues, system constraints, and milestone risks.

Develop team members through coaching, feedback, and a strong engineering culture built on ownership, transparency, and continuous improvement.

Must-have qualifications

• Bachelor’s or master’s degree in Automotive Engineering, Computer Engineering, Electrical-Electronics, Electronics-Telecommunication, Mechatronics Engineering, or related fields.

• Strong project management, risk management, and stakeholder management capability.

• Good understanding of software development life-cycles, preferably in embedded or automotive software.

• Good English communication skills, with the ability to work across cultures and time zones.

Strong ownership, problem-solving mindset, teamwork spirit, and willingness to lead in a complex technical environment.

Nice-to-have skills

• Experience in embedded software development or automotive software project management.

• Knowledge of automotive system, especially braking systems, ESP, in-vehicle communication, or automotive safety standards.

• Exposure to functional safety, cybersecurity, ASPICE, or automotive quality processes.

Practical experience using AI tools, automation, dashboards, or data analysis to improve daily project management work.

PMP, ScrumMaster, or equivalent certification is a plus.

Chinese language capability is a strong advantage.
